Webgo-between. (n.) "one who passes between parties in a negotiation or intrigue," 1590s, from verbal phrase go between in obsolete sense "act as a mediator" (1540s), from go (v.) + … WebThe process used by OD practitioners to design and implement organizational development strategies is structured in five phases: Entry represents the initial contact between …

We've listed any clues from our database that match … rif annyWebJul 24, 2015 · Add a comment. 2. Just "between f ( a) and f ( b) ", for example, means in majority of cases a non-strict inequality. The usage of "between" instead of the inequality itself is dictated by the uncertainty of which of those two values is smaller. We cannot just write f ( a) ≤ k ≤ f ( b), since it may happen that f ( b) < f ( a). rif camoplaWebThe Go-Between. The Go-Between is a novel by L. P. Hartley published in 1953.
